Output 5ecb9771783bf92f039a194428c2643a2eb543c6c9b7d86b0509f011d6118b07:1

value
101766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8502187d5bda48149f881f454880e15e588cc461 OP_EQUAL
address
3DpJJfc3KyMDWH96ersFdRbDQ5fyna3Bgc
transaction
5ecb9771783bf92f039a194428c2643a2eb543c6c9b7d86b0509f011d6118b07
spent
true